Some SSI and MSI chips, like discrete transistors, remain mass-developed, both of those to keep up aged machines and Make new products that require only a few gates. The 7400 number of TTL chips, such as, has become a de facto conventional and stays in generation.

Dopants are impurities deliberately introduced to the semiconductor to modulate its electronic Homes. Doping is the whole process of including dopants to a semiconductor substance.
